
Watch Amazon's Alexa summon a Tesla Model S out of a garage
If you own a Tesla Model S or Model X you've been able to summon your all-electric carfor nearly six months now, but one developer has created an even cooler way with Amazon's Echo. Using an unofficial Tesla API and the Echo, Jason Goecke created code that runs in the cloud to respond to keyword triggers with Alexa. "Ask KITT" (because everyone wants a Knight Rider car) is the command to pull the car out of the garage, and the video demonstration shows it working effortlessly

Windows 10 upgrades will cost $119 after July 29
if you've been dragging your heels on upgrading to Windows 10, now is the time to take action. Free upgrades to the new OS from previous versions of Windows will end on July 29, Microsoft reiterated today. The company initially said the offer would only last one year, and indeed that date marks Windows 10's first anniversary. The next 'Battlefield' drops you in WWI, launches on October 21st
EA and developer Dice today revealed the next major entry in the venerable warfare series Battlefield. Just as the rumor mill believed, the game will be set in World War I -- and the new game, appropriately, is titled Battlefield 1. "We chose the name because we're going back to the true dawn of all out warfare," lead game designer Daniel Berlin said at a private event near San Francisco for press and fans, "and this is the genesis of what modern warfare is today."
